Average Costs Of Full-Thickness Skin Graft

A full-thickness skin graft transplants all layers of skin (epidermis and dermis) from a donor site, typically for smaller, more complex defects requiring better cosmetic outcomes, popular in advanced centers.

Average Costs Of Meshed Skin Graft

A meshed skin graft features small perforations in the graft to improve contouring, adhesion, and coverage of larger wounds, often used in burn treatments.

Average Costs Of Micrografting with ReCell Technology

Micrografting with ReCell technology processes small skin samples into a cell suspension sprayed onto the wound, promoting faster healing and reduced scarring in international advanced centers.

Average Costs Of Skin Flap Procedure

A skin flap procedure transfers skin with its blood supply intact to areas needing enhanced vascularization or structural support, preferred for complex defects in medical tourism hubs like South Korea.

Average Costs Of Split-Thickness Skin Graft

A split-thickness skin graft involves transplanting the top two layers of skin (epidermis and part of the dermis) from a donor site to cover larger areas of damaged skin, commonly used for burns and widely sought in medical tourism destinations like Turkey and India.

Travel and Visa Convenience

Traveling from Serbia to Turkey is straightforward; most airlines operate multiple daily flights between Belgrade and Istanbul, often lasting less than two hours. Turkish e‑visa policy allows Serbian citizens to... tain an electronic visa online within minutes, though travelers should always verify the latest requirements before booking. Once in Istanbul, patients benefit from a wide range of accommodation options ranging from budget hotels to luxury resorts, many of which work closely with medical centers to streamline airport transfers and appointment logistics. Clinics typically provide concierge services that assist with visa paperwork, local transportation, and language support, ensuring a smooth journey from arrival to post‑procedure recovery.
